What was reported
The finding
In September 2025 xAI laid off about 500 employees, including roughly a third of its data annotation team. Internal emails reported by Business Insider indicated the company was eliminating most generalist tutor roles, and xAI publicly said it planned to expand its team of expert tutors in fields such as science, medicine and finance tenfold. In 2026, sources told Bloomberg that xAI had paused hiring human AI tutors, with recruiting operations strained as the company struggled to process incoming candidates efficiently.
xAI laid off about 500 people including roughly a third of its data annotation team, with reporting indicating most generalist tutor roles were eliminated. It then said publicly it would expand expert tutors in science, medicine and finance by ten times. In 2026 it paused tutor hiring entirely, with sources telling Bloomberg that recruiting had become strained by candidate volume.
What the listings pay
Read those together and you get both halves of the honest picture. The demand is shifting decisively toward verified expertise, and it is not a smooth or reliable ramp. A company can announce a tenfold expansion and pause hiring in the same twelve months.

How this compares across the board
A rate only means something next to the alternatives. This is every category we track with at least five listings publishing a rate, ranked by median top-of-range, so you can see where this work sits rather than taking a single number on trust.
| Category | Listings | Median low | Median top | Highest |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Legal | 95 | $100 | $140 | $400 |
| Medical | 68 | $77 | $120 | $400 |
| Consulting | 45 | $80 | $120 | $280 |
| Finance | 94 | $80 | $110 | $280 |
| Engineering | 114 | $70 | $100 | $300 |
| Research/PhD | 132 | $70 | $90 | $280 |
| Writing | 36 | $40 | $80 | $280 |
| Bilingual | 78 | $44 | $52 | $120 |
| Annotation | 25 | $12 | $24 | $120 |
Same source and date as above. Categories are matched on listing title, so a role can appear in more than one.
